Instantiation of handler class
The commit adds implementation of handler class.
Mostly, oem specific implementation has been moved from manager class
to handler class.

+ private:
+ /**
+ * @brief API to set timer to detect system VPD over D-Bus.
+ *
+ * System VPD is required before bus name for VPD-Manager is claimed. Once
+ * system VPD is published, VPD for other FRUs should be collected. This API
+ * detects id system VPD is already published on D-Bus and based on that
+ * triggers VPD collection for rest of the FRUs.
+ *
+ * Note: Throws exception in case of any failure. Needs to be handled by the
+ * caller.
+ */
+ void SetTimerToDetectSVPDOnDbus();
+
+ /**
+ * @brief Set timer to detect and set VPD collection status for the system.
+ *
+ * Collection of FRU VPD is triggered in a separate thread. Resulting in
+ * multiple threads at a given time. The API creates a timer which on
+ * regular interval will check if all the threads were collected back and
+ * sets the status of the VPD collection for the system accordingly.
+ *
+ * @throw std::runtime_error
+ */
+ void SetTimerToDetectVpdCollectionStatus();
+
+ /**
+ * @brief API to register callback for "AssetTag" property change.
+ */
+ void registerAssetTagChangeCallback();
+
+ /**
+ * @brief Callback API to be triggered on "AssetTag" property change.
+ *
+ * @param[in] i_msg - The callback message.
+ */
+ void processAssetTagChangeCallback(sdbusplus::message_t& i_msg);
+
+ /**
+ * @brief API to process VPD collection thread failed EEPROMs.
+ */
+ void processFailedEeproms();
+
+ /**
+ * @brief API to check and update PowerVS VPD.
+ *
+ * The API will read the existing data from the DBus and if found
+ * different than what has been read from JSON, it will update the VPD with
+ * JSON data on hardware and DBus both.
+ *
+ * @param[in] i_powerVsJsonObj - PowerVS JSON object.
+ * @param[out] o_failedPathList - List of path failed to update.
+ */
+ void checkAndUpdatePowerVsVpd(const nlohmann::json& i_powerVsJsonObj,
+ std::vector<std::string>& o_failedPathList);
+ /**
+ * @brief API to handle configuration w.r.t. PowerVS systems.
+ *
+ * Some FRUs VPD is specific to powerVS system. The API detects the
+ * powerVS configuration and updates the VPD accordingly.
+ */
+ void ConfigurePowerVsSystem();
